1. Research Your Options: Understanding Different Types of Braces
Before diving into orthodontic treatment, take the time to research the various types of braces available. From traditional metal braces to clear aligners and lingual braces, each option offers unique benefits and considerations. 2. Evaluate Your Budget: Understanding the Cost of Treatment
Orthodontic treatment can be a significant investment, so it’s essential to evaluate your budget and understand the cost of braces beforehand. In addition to the initial cost of braces, factor in expenses such as adjustments, retainers, and potential unforeseen circumstances. Many orthodontic practices offer payment plans or financing options to help make treatment more affordable. Take the time to explore your financial options and determine a budget that works for you.
3. Schedule Consultations: Meeting with Orthodontic Professionals
Before committing to orthodontic treatment, schedule consultations with orthodontic professionals to discuss your options and expectations. During these consultations, orthodontists will assess your oral health, discuss treatment goals, and recommend the most suitable course of action. 4. Address Oral Health Issues: Preparing Your Mouth for Braces
Before getting braces, it’s essential to address any existing oral health issues to ensure the best possible outcomes. Book an appointment to address issues such as tooth decay, gum disease, or misalignment. Addressing these issues before beginning orthodontic treatment can help prevent complications and ensure a smoother, more successful braces experience.
5. Plan for Maintenance: Establishing Oral Hygiene Habits
Maintaining good oral hygiene is crucial, especially during orthodontic treatment. Before getting braces, establish a solid oral hygiene routine that includes brushing, flossing, and regular dental check-ups. Orthodontic appliances can make it more challenging to clean your teeth effectively, so it’s essential to be diligent about oral hygiene to prevent issues such as tooth decay or gum disease. Your orthodontist can provide guidance on proper maintenance techniques tailored to your specific treatment plan.
6. Prepare for Adjustments: Understanding the Treatment Process
Orthodontic treatment requires regular adjustments to ensure progress and achieve optimal results. Before getting braces, familiarize yourself with the treatment process and what to expect during appointments. Understand that adjustments may cause temporary discomfort or changes in speech and eating habits. Having a clear understanding of the treatment process can help alleviate anxiety and ensure a more positive braces experience.
